Time comparator
This module compares the current day and time with the respective day activation
hour
xxx Act hour
and activation minute
xxx Act Min
settings. When the time of the day
reaches the set activation time, output
Q
is activated. It remains activate for the
duration defined by the setting
xxx Act Dur
.
The output remains active until the next day if the setting for
xxx Act
Dur
is set such that it results into rollover of the day.
Different activation and deactivation times can be set for all days of the week. The
activation and deactivation can also be disabled for a specific day, for example, if the
activation or deactivation is not needed on Sundays, the
Sunday Act enable
can be set
"False".
Activation of the
BLOCK
input deactivates the function output whereas the activation
of
FREEZE
input freezes the output. The
BLOCK
input has always a higher priority
than the
FREEZE
input.

Application
The daily timer function is useful in applications that require signal activation and
deactivation at a specific time of the day. Different activation times and duration can
be set for different days of the week. For example, if the signal should be active on
Mondays between 7.15 a.m. and 4 p.m., the
Monday Act enable
setting should be
"1=True",
Mon Act hour
and
Mon Act Mn
as "07" for hours and "15" for minutes
respectively and
Mon Act Dur
should be "525" minutes. The behavior of output
Q
is
